Small businesses are increasingly becoming targets for cyber threats. Understanding their impact is vital for proactive risk management.
Small businesses often lack the resources to implement robust security measures, making them attractive targets for cybercriminals.
Cyber breaches can lead to significant financial losses due to data theft, operational disruption, and potential legal fees.
Data breaches can severely damage a small business's reputation, leading to loss of customer trust and loyalty.
Investing in cyber security measures, such as employee training, regular software updates, and implementing firewalls, can help mitigate risks.
By recognizing the impact of cyber threats, small businesses can take proactive steps to protect their data and ensure the privacy of their customers.
